This extended semi-detached house on Green Lane has been fully renovated and offers modern, family-friendly living across two floors. The ground floor features an open-plan kitchen/diner with a contemporary island, skylight and underfloor heating throughout, creating a bright, comfortable entertaining space. Off-street parking and a fully enclosed rear garden make day-to-day family life straightforward.
Internally there are three bedrooms and a single family bathroom on the first floor; room sizes are standard for a property of this era and total internal area is approximately 965 sq ft. The layout suits a growing family or buyers seeking a spacious, ready-to-move-in home without immediate works. Broadband speeds are fast and mobile signal is excellent, supporting home working and connectivity.
Practical positives include the newly fitted kitchen with integrated appliances, utility area, ground-floor WC and driveway parking. The property is chain-free and freehold, located close to Cross Gates train station, local shops and several 'Good' primary and secondary schools, which is helpful for school runs and commuting.
Notable considerations: the house has a single family bathroom only and a small plot with driveway room for one car, which may be limiting for larger families or multiple drivers. The EPC rating is C; heating is mains gas via boiler and radiators plus ground-floor underfloor heating. Buyers should note the house is post-war (1930–1949) construction with double glazing of unknown age.
